Does anyone have any experience with this scope?

Several here swear by the fixed-power SWFA SS scopes, but how does their variable power compare to other variables in the same price range?

I have 2 and they've been great for my needs. On a 223 and 22-250, adjustments are spot on, RTZ is great and no loss of zero. My teen boys use em and I'm quite sure they get banged around and beaten on. So far, well worth the $
